Using full screen mode
Maximize your website preview to see more of your site while you build and edit content.
Full screen mode hides the sidebar and expands your website preview to fill the entire screen, giving you more space to see how your site looks while you work.
Entering full screen mode
- In the website builder, find the Full screen button in the toolbar at the top right
- Click Full screen
The sidebar closes and your preview expands to fill the screen.
What full screen mode shows
When you enter full screen:
- The preview fills your entire browser window
- The sidebar with editing tools is hidden
- Page tabs remain visible at the top
- You can still navigate between pages
Exiting full screen mode
You have two options to exit:
Option 1: Click the exit button
An Exit full screen button appears inside the preview. Click it to return to normal view.
Option 2: Press ESC
Press the ESC key on your keyboard to exit full screen mode.

Editing in full screen mode
You can't edit sections while in full screen mode. To make changes:
- Exit full screen mode
- Click a section to edit it
- Make your changes
- Enter full screen again to see the result
Tips
Use full screen to check your overall design. After adding several sections, enter full screen mode to see how everything flows together.
Combine with mobile preview. You can use full screen mode while viewing the mobile version of your site.
Quick exit with ESC. If you need to make a quick edit, press ESC to exit immediately.
